Document Description
The proposed project involves the refurbishment of the Children's Training dock at the CYC located at 1631 Strand Way in the city. The proposed project would involve removal of the dock's existing surface planks and replacement with new planks to improve its usability, longevity, and appearance. No increase in overwater coverage would result from implementation of the proposed project. Work to specifically complete the proposed project would include the following: removal of the existing approx 5,200 sf of decking planks and associated fixing screws; and installation of replacement PVC plastic decking planks and fascia boards. Debris removed from the dock would be stored onsite in the maintenance yard in a dedicated and covered container for eventual off-site disposal. A pre-construction eelgrass survey conducted by Merkel & Associates, Inc. on April 12, 2018, determined that eelgrass occurs within the proposed project area. However, due to the limited scope of the proposed project and construction methods, no impacts are anticipated. It is anticipated that construction of the proposed project would begin mid-year and would have a total construction period of approx 6 months, weather permitting. Due to its nature and limited scope, construction of the proposed project would generate approx 2 vehicle trips associated with hauling of construction demolition debris. Furthermore, the proposed project would require limited use of construction equipment. Therefore, no impacts are anticipated. Furthermore, the applicant is responsible for complying with all applicable federal, state, and local laws regulating construction demolition debris, hazards and hazardous materials, noise, and stormwater. Finally, the applicant is in the process of or has obtained the following approvals and/or permits: Army Corps of Engineers permit and Clean Water Act Section 401 Certification.

Notice of Exemption

Exempt Status
Categorical Exemption
Type, Section or Code
15301, 15302
Reasons for Exemption
The refurbishment of the decking of an existing recreational boating dock that would involve no expansion of use beyond that previously existing and would have no permanent effects on the environment.
